What is there to do near my all-inclusive resort in Chania?
If you want to explore the area around your all-inclusive resort, visit Agia Marina Beach and Maritime Museum of Crete, and see why travellers like the beaches and culture in Chania. Other attractions include Old Venetian Harbor, Agora and Chania Central Market.
When's the best time for an all-inclusive stay in Chania?
There's nothing like an all-inclusive holiday in Chania to rejuvenate you, especially when you know what to expect from the elements. Here's some information to help you choose when to book: The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 13°C. July and August are the driest months, while December and January are the rainiest months.
